Newstalk At its height in , Playboy 's circulation was more than 7 million copies per month. Yet Hugh Hefner still had to work to convince advertisers that men read the magazine for something more than the articles. The company ran this ad campaign—"What kind of man reads Playboy?
Newer Post Older Post Home. There is a full page color advertisement that generally depicts a man and at least one woman. The scene within the ad changes with each issue but it is always fresh and upbeat, such as an outdoor scene, an art gallery, or steps at some college campus. Although he may pay no attention to the ad at first, his subconscious is working its will. More than likely the reader will be influenced by the ad at its face value, the subconscious will not have to interpret it for him.
The advertisement is blunt and it draws on direct feedback, the purchase of another issue. Simply put, Playboy uses shameless visual and written appeals in their self advertisements in attempt to sell more magazines by drawing on mens social concepts. In writing this, it is my goal to decipher the meaning and intentions of this ad so that not only the message will be apparent but also Playboys manipulation of its audience.

I have obtained three consecutive issues of Playboy consisting of August October The August issue contained topics such as sports and sex, and women of the Olympics. Recreation and outdoor-sports enthusiasts were a few of the choice words used in the rock climbing ad while the laptop ad talked about higher education and male college readers.
Like the futuristic portrayals of bachelor pads in Playboy , these advertisements seem to portray more of the image Playboy has always had of itself more than the actual demographics of the readers.
Yet, advertising revenue today in Playboy is best predicted by the woman on the cover. It appears that advertisers never bought the hype.
